    We present advances in hadronic object tagging for the Phase 2 Upgrade of the CMS Level 1 Trigger. With advances in Fast Machine Learning; more powerful FPGA processors; and the introduction of track and particle flow reconstruction at the Level 1 Trigger, jet tagging will become feasible for the first time in this system.     We present a convolutional neural network (CNN) for real-time jet substructure identification in the ATLAS hardware trigger at the High-Luminosity LHC (HL-LHC).
